Woman Dies After Riding Drayton’s “Maelstrom”

Woman Dies After Riding Drayton’s “Maelstrom”

Tragic news emerged from Drayton Manor Theme Park over the weekend as Carla Knight, 42 and mother of two collapsed after exiting the “Maelstrom” ride – which is a gyro swing attraction where rides spin and swing simultaneously. Carla suffered a cardiac arrest and despite best efforts from first-aiders and paramedics, she sadly died at the scene while out with her family.

She was pronounced dead at the scene, and the ride was closed for several hours while police searched the area. They have now determined there were no suspicious circumstances involved.

Colin Bryan, Managing Director at Drayton Manor Park, said: “On Friday, a woman aged 42 was at the park enjoying a day out when sadly, having left the Maelstrom ride, she passed away after having a cardiac arrest.

“The on-site first aid team and all emergency services acted quickly as well as an off-duty doctor who assisted immediately.

“Our wishes and thoughts are with her family and friends at this devastating time.”

A spokesman for Staffordshire Police said: “We were called to a report of a collapsed woman at Drayton Manor Park just after 11.35am on Friday 3 August.

“Officers attended and sadly, colleagues from the ambulance service confirmed the woman had died.

“We can confirm there are no suspicious circumstances and a report will be prepared for Her Majesty’s Coroner.”

The description of ‘Maelstrom’, which is Swiss made, reads: “A million pound stomach-churning gyro-swing that makes your face outwards!

“This amazing thrill ride swings to a height of 22.5 metres and spins at the same time.”
